AvailableDr. Bobbie Strange is a large male domestic short hair cat with a mysterious background, approximately 4 years old and currently living in Bourbonnais, IL. He is neutered and up to date on vaccinations. Though his full physical description is still coming into focus, his big presence is already clear.

What type of living environment is this breed usually best suited for?
Dr. Bobbie Strange, as a domestic short hair, adapts well to a variety of living spaces, from apartments to larger homes. He's content as long as he has cozy spots to explore and rest.
How much outdoor space does this breed typically need?
Domestic short hairs like Dr. Bobbie Strange usually thrive as indoor cats and don't require outdoor space. A stimulating indoor environment with room to roam suits him well.
Is this breed typically suitable for homes with children?
Domestic short hair cats such as Dr. Bobbie Strange often do well in homes with children, especially if introduced gradually and with respect for his boundaries.
